7491. Pirenzepine

Nomenclature

CAS number: 28797-61-7
5,11-Dihydro-11-[(4-methyl-1-piperazinyl)acetyl]-6H-pyrido[2,3-b][1,4]benzodiazepin-6-one; LS-519.
C19H21N5O2; mol wt 351.40.
C 64.94%, H 6.02%, N 19.93%, O 9.11%.

Description and references

Tricyclic gastric-acid inhibitor. Prepn: FR 1505795 (1967 to Thomae), C.A. 70, 4154w (1969). Pharmacology: W. Eberlein et al., Arzneim.-Forsch. 27, 356 (1977). Pharmacokinetics: R. Hammes et al., ibid. 928. Mechanism of action: G. Heller et al., Verh. Dtsch. Ges. Inn. Med. 84, 991 (1978), C.A. 90, 132984s (1979). Human pharmacology: H. Brunner et al., Arzneim.-Forsch. 27, 684 (1977). Multicenter controlled clinical trial: Scand. J. Gastroenterol. 17, Suppl. 81, 1-42 (1982). Radioimmunoassay determn in human plasma and urine: C. A. Homon et al., Ther. Drug Monit. 9, 236 (1987). Symposium: ibid. Suppl. 72, 1-273. Review of pharmacology and therapeutic efficacy: A. A. Carmine, R. N. Brogden, Drugs 30, 85-126 (1985). Comprehensive description: H. A. El-Obeid et al., Anal. Profiles Drug Subs. 16, 445-506 (1987).

Derivative

Dihydrochloride.

Nomenclature

CAS number: 29868-97-1
LS-519-Cl2; Duogastral (ISM); Durapirenz (Durachemie); Gasteril (Ripari-Gero); Gastrozepin (Thomae); Leblon (De Angeli); Maghen (Savio); Renzepin (Bergamon); Tabe (Bernabo); Ulcuforton (Plantorgan); Ulcosan (Dompé).
C19H21N5O2.2HCl; mol wt 424.32.
C 53.78%, H 5.46%, N 16.50%, O 7.54%, Cl 16.71%.

Properties

Sol in water, slightly sol in methanol. Practically insol in ether.

Therapeutic Category

Antiulcerative.
